Output 24dd81060bcac68c1c692ef10ac32a3d3518bd671f65b608278683953aa8259d:1

value
17626639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5a7601a20ede255d2f8ee27fba6d1b6eea9423e OP_EQUALVERIFY OP_CHECKSIG
address
1PPu4Sp63GxiXzMgEKpeFaXYMP1pNCpYUq
transaction
24dd81060bcac68c1c692ef10ac32a3d3518bd671f65b608278683953aa8259d
spent
true